Output 6311bed385db28dd340b65c4059e0c342595b332d4b9f8a01840d1cdd9564274:0

value
678829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6474b803cdc93e79dc5e339847980570432814a4 OP_EQUAL
address
3ArBKVUWRjBV5AjVEXY2DgSYNzoxxAk3uz
transaction
6311bed385db28dd340b65c4059e0c342595b332d4b9f8a01840d1cdd9564274
spent
true